Atrybut text-transform w CSS
- Poprzednia strona text-shadow
- Następna strona text-underline-offset
Definicja i użycie
text-transform właściwość kontroluje wielkość liter w tekście.
Opis
Ta właściwość zmienia wielkość liter w elementach, niezależnie od wielkości liter w tekście źródłowym. Jeśli wartością jest capitalize, niektóre litery mają być pisane z dużych liter, ale nie jest określone, jak określić, które litery mają być pisane z dużych liter, co zależy od tego, jak użytkownik agent识别出各个“词”.
Zobacz również:
CSS Tutorial:Tekst w CSS
HTML DOM Reference Manual:textTransform właściwość
Przykład
Przekształcanie tekstu w różnych elementach:
h1 {text-transform:uppercase;} h2 {text-transform:capitalize;} p {text-transform:lowercase;}
Wskazówki i komentarze
Komentarz:Różne użytkownicy mogą używać różnych metod do określenia, gdzie słowo zaczyna się, co odpowiada określeniu, które litery mają być pisane z dużych liter. Na przykład, tekst "w3-school" może być wyświetlony na dwa sposoby: "W3-school" i "W3-School". CSS nie określa, które z nich jest poprawne, więc oba są dopuszczalne.
CSS syntax
text-transform: none|capitalize|uppercase|lowercase|initial|inherit;
Wartość atrybutu
Wartość | Opis |
---|---|
none | Domyślnie. Definiuje standardowy tekst z małymi i dużymi literami. |
capitalize | Każde słowo w tekście zaczyna się od dużej litery. |
uppercase | Definiuje jedynie duże litery. |
lowercase | Definiuje brak dużych liter, jedynie małe litery. |
inherit | Definiuje, że wartość text-transform powinna być dziedziczona od elementu nadrzędnego. |
Techniczne szczegóły
Domyślna wartość: | none |
---|---|
Inheritance: | yes |
Wersja: | CSS1 |
JavaScript syntax: | object.style.textTransform="uppercase" |
Więcej przykładów
- Kontrolowanie wielkości liter w tekście
- Ten przykład pokazuje, jak kontrolować wielkość liter w tekście.
Obsługa przeglądarek
Liczby w tabeli wskazują na pierwszą wersję przeglądarki, która w pełni obsługuje tę właściwość.
Chrome | IE / Edge | Firefox | Safari | Opera |
---|---|---|---|---|
1.0 | 4.0 | 1.0 | 1.0 | 7.0 |
- Poprzednia strona text-shadow
- Następna strona text-underline-offset